The Samsung Galaxy S25 Edge could be the next launch of the major smartphone of the year – we will see it in April, and this is certainly credible given how apparently the device is.
The latest leaks give us a more in-depth look at the supposed colors of the phone, with South Korean Youtuber Le Sinza (via Android Authority) showing dummy units in black and white shades.
These dummy units are not functional handsets, but are likely to show the correct dimensions, as well as port and button investments, because the dummy units tend to be used by accessory manufacturers so that they can design cases before the launch of a phone.

Awkward placement
Thus, in other words, the overall form that we see here can be precise – which is slightly unhappy, because although the Samsung Galaxy S25 edge seems correctly thin, you can see that its USB -C load port and its SIM card location are both out of center; Or more specifically, they are housed closer to the bottom of the frame than the top.
Although this may mean that these dummy units are not accurate, we would assume that it is just as likely that it is a compromise of design that Samsung adapts to all the components of such a thin handset.
In any case, with the two colors here – which certainly seem fairly striking – Samsung would also be shipped the Galaxy S25 Edge in a titanium icyblue shade. Indeed, more evidence for this comes from certain wallpapers disclosed for the phone, shared by Max Jambor on X, which seem to correspond to the three colors of the handset.
Unfortunately, we have no imagery of the appearance of this shade on the phone itself, but it could well be the most interesting of the three.
We should soon get an official overview of all colors, because – as spotted by 91mobiles (via phandroid) – the Samsung Galaxy S25 EDGE was also certified by the FCC (Federal Communications Commission).
Unfortunately, certification does not reveal much, but the phone would only be certified near the launch, so we could well see the Galaxy S25 Edge in April or May. Until recently, most leaks highlighted an unveiling in May, but the last release date on the release date indicates an advertisement on April 16. So the wait could really be almost over.
